2019-01-04

This commit is contained in:
monlor
2019-01-04 23:35:20 +08:00
parent c2cd4e9d9d
commit 3d758f4c67
9 changed files with 16 additions and 16 deletions

View File

@@ -53,10 +53,10 @@ vsftpd() {
[ "$res" == '1' ] && vsftpdAdd
read -p "删除${appname}用户?[1/0] " res
[ "$res" == '1' ] && vsftpdDel
if [ "$(mbdb get entware.main.enable)" = '1' ]; then
readsh "使用entware安装插件程序[1/0]" "entware" "1"
[ "$entware" = '1' ] && mv ${mbroot}/apps/${appname}/bin/${appname} ${mbroot}/apps/${appname}/bin/${appname}.bak &> /dev/null
fi
# if [ "$(mbdb get entware.main.enable)" = '1' ]; then
# readsh "使用entware安装插件程序[1/0]" "entware" "1"
# [ "$entware" = '1' ] && mv ${mbroot}/apps/${appname}/bin/${appname} ${mbroot}/apps/${appname}/bin/${appname}.bak &> /dev/null
# fi
readsh "请输入${appname}外网访问配置[1/0]" "openport" "1"
${mbroot}/apps/${appname}/scripts/${appname}.sh restart

View File

@@ -4,7 +4,7 @@ eval `mbdb export vsftpd`
port=21
FTPUSER=${mbroot}/apps/vsftpd/config/ftpuser.conf
binname="${appname} ${appname}-ext"
# binname="${appname} ${appname}-ext"
add(){
sed -i "/$1/"d /etc/passwd
@@ -82,16 +82,16 @@ start () {
exit 1
fi
logsh "$service" "正在启动${appname}服务... "
if [ ! -f ${mbroot}/apps/${appname}/bin/${appname} ]; then
bincheck ${binname}
if [ $? -eq 0 ]; then
logsh "$service" "安装程序成功,链接程序到工具箱..."
ln -sf $(which $binname) ${mbroot}/apps/${appname}/bin/${appname}
else
logsh "$service" "程序安装失败!"
end
fi
fi
# if [ ! -f ${mbroot}/apps/${appname}/bin/${appname} ]; then
# bincheck ${binname}
# if [ $? -eq 0 ]; then
# logsh "【$service】" "安装程序成功,链接程序到工具箱..."
# ln -sf $(which $binname) ${mbroot}/apps/${appname}/bin/${appname}
# else
# logsh "【$service】" "程序安装失败!"
# end
# fi
# fi
# init_mount
set_config

Binary file not shown.

Binary file not shown.

Binary file not shown.

View File

@@ -17,7 +17,7 @@ logsh "【Tools】" "请按任意键安装工具箱(Ctrl + C 退出)."
read answer
#check root
# [ "$USER" != "root" ] && logsh "【Tools】" "请使用root用户安装工具箱" && exit 1
mburl="https://dev.tencent.com/u/monlor/p/MIXBOX-BETA/git/raw/master"
mburl="https://raw.githubusercontent.com/MIXBOX/master"
mbtmp="/tmp/mbtmp"
[ ! -d "${mbtmp}" ] && mkdir -p ${mbtmp}
model=$(uname -ms | tr ' ' '_' | tr '[A-Z]' '[a-z]')